Are you looking for an easy way to secure your Chromebook? Password safety is one of the simplest yet most important steps to ensure your private information is protected from malicious actors. With the right strategies, you can keep your data safe and secure.
Using passwords to secure your online accounts is the first step towards better protection. Strong passwords are composed of a combination of numbers and letters and should be changed regularly. It’s also important to never keep the same password for different accounts. When creating a new password, make sure it is unique and not easily guessed.
- Use a password manager – Password managers help you create and store passwords in an encrypted format, making them much more difficult for cybercriminals to steal.
- Enable two-factor authentication – Setting up two-factor authentication adds an extra layer of protection to your accounts. This means that in addition to entering your password, you will also need a unique code or token that is sent to your smartphone or email in order to log in.
- Change passwords on a regular basis – Change your passwords every 3 months or whenever you feel that they have been compromised. This prevents cyber criminals from obtaining access to your accounts.
By following these simple steps, you can ensure your online privacy and security for years to come.

3. Follow These Steps to Change Your Password on Chromebook
Ready to change your Chromebook password? No problem. Just follow these steps:
- Click the account image at the bottom right. This is the image you associated with your Google account. You’ll know if you’ve done it right when a pop-up window appears on the screen.
- Click the gear icon – You’ll see a gear icon in the top right corner of the pop-up window. Click it to access your Chromebook settings.
- Look for the Password section – Scroll down until you find the “Passwords” section. This is where you can adjust your account settings.
- Click Change Password – A new window will appear. Follow the steps provided to create your new password.
- Restart your Chromebook – After you’ve set your password, restart your Chromebook to make sure it saves your new information.
That’s all there is to it! Just remember that you’ll need to use your new password to log back into your Chromebook. And if you ever need to change your password again, you can always access “Passwords” in your settings.

Q: How do I change the password for my Chromebook?
A: It’s easy to change your password on a Chromebook! Just follow these steps:
1. Click your profile picture in the lower-right corner of your Chromebook’s screen.
2. Select “Settings.”
3. Click “Manage People” in the People section.
4. Select “Change Password” next to your profile name.
5. Enter your current password.
6. Enter and confirm your new password.
7. Click “Change Password.”
And now your Chromebook will have a new, secure password!
